Abstract
A surgical fixation system for stabilizing spinous processes of adjacent vertebral bodies relative to one another comprising at least one first fixing element and at least one second fixing element, which can be transferred relative to one another from an insertion position into an implantation position, wherein the fixing elements in the implantation position have a smaller spacing from one another than in the insertion position and in which implantation position the fixing elements are engageable laterally from different sides with at least one of the spinous processes in each case, and comprising a securing device for securing the fixing elements relative to one another in the implantation position and comprising at least one spacer element, which can be fixed by the fixing elements in the implantation position thereof in the intervertebral space between the spinous processes.

26. A method for stabilizing spinous processes of adjacent vertebral bodies relative to one another, in which a sternal closure device described in the document DE 103 26 690 B4 or a fixing device described in the document DE 10 2006 021 025 B3 is used to stabilize the spinous processes, with at least one spacer element being positioned between two fixing elements of the fixing system in the intervertebral space between the spinous processes.
